Car Play screen scratches so easily.

What kind of cheap shit is this? I literally have 200 miles on my car, and the screen has scratches all over it. Easily seen if you look at an angle. I googled, on people on the other 4Runner forum seem to have this issue as well. I take it others here have it as well, and just live with it?
